The contact owns a 2014 Dodge Charger. The contact stated that while driving at an undisclosed speed, the vehicle stalled without warning. The contact also stated that there was no visible warning indicators while the parking brake was activated and the vehicle was shifted to the park position. The vehicle was towed to arrigo Dodge Chrysler Jeep Ram sawgrass, (5901 madison ave, tamarac, fl 33321, (954) 626-8811) and was diagnosed that the alternator failed and needed to be replaced. The contact also stated that a new battery was also needed. The vehicle was repaired. The manufacturer was made aware of the failure and referred the contact to NHTSA. The failure mileage was approximately 100,000.

Defective left cylinder in pentastar 3.6vl engine. My car was built in September 2013. It has the constant ticking and puttering associated with the defect. Drives fine, may or may not have the check engine light on, but when idle it shakes/knocks uncontrollably. My mechanic educated me on the defect after many attempts at repairing the severe misfiring. Contacted Dodge and Chrysler and was informed that because my car is a 2014 Charger it did not have the 150,000 extended warranty for his known defect in Chargers from 2011-2103; noting mine was built in 2013.

The contact owned a 2014 Dodge Charger. While driving various speeds, the vehicle suddenly shut off. The vehicle was taken to landmark Dodge Chrysler Jeep Ram (6850 mt. Zion blvd, morrow, ga), but the cause of the failure could not be determined. After retrieving the vehicle, the failure continued. While driving approximately 35 mph, the vehicle suddenly shut off. As a result, the driver lost control and crashed into a utility pole. The driver sustained chest and facial injuries that required medical attention. A police report was filed. The vehicle was destroyed and towed to an undisclosed location. The cause of the failure was not determined. The dealer and manufacturer were not notified. The failure mileage was 30,000. The VIN was not available.

Car experienced rapid alternator failure. Requested Dodge repair as part of recall, however they refused stating recall was limited to 160amp alternator and my Charger had 180amp. After some research in Chrysler forums, both the 160amp and 180 amp alternators are experiencing the same type of failure. Both should be on the recall list!
